Output 58616ece571e6ee3512b5644150ece6d545b6e3c988571fbb724c375c1550b8b:6

value
57098298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ecdc2ee7156919787c14017e16f210fcde3ae987 OP_EQUALVERIFY OP_CHECKSIG
address
1NbQEsTD17RJKsQ3M8hAE1f51YsDarQxjT
transaction
58616ece571e6ee3512b5644150ece6d545b6e3c988571fbb724c375c1550b8b
spent
true